Your FASTA data needs updating on the BMW backend.
This should be done automatically as soon as a full vehicle test is done in ISTA+. Any dealer should be able to do it , or anyone with AOS access local to you |

BMW suspect that the update was done incorrectly by the dealer which I find hard to believe This is what BMW say:- Good afternoon Stuart Many thanks for your response and continued patience in this matter. I've now had a response from the technical support team and they have advised that the software has not been updated/installed in your BMW 320d correctly. The software may be showing as up to date in your vehicle's iDrive, but this has not be installed correctly which is why the My BMW App is showing the software version differently. I'd suggest contacting your preferred BMW Center to get this issue looked into further - click here to find the contact details for your preferred BMW Center. I realise this may not be the response you're looking for but I hope it's clarified the situation I hope this is helpful and if there's anything else I can help you with, please let me know. The dealer seems to think it is possible the update did not install right ... his reply, interesting bit about whole car and head unit! Hi Stuart, The car will be sorted when we fully update the cars software (not just the head unit). I have every confidence that this will resolve the issue going forwards.
